Covid-19 has produced the biggest change in the organisation of UK general practice for 200 years. As in many countries, face-to-face consultations have fallen to about 10% of their previous level and most contacts are now provided remotely using symptom checkers, electronic messaging, and phone or video consultations. Several of these changes may be permanent, with fewer face-to-face consultations in future. Opportunity and danger are two aspects of change: both now apply to general practice.
